When you obtain an indexed universal life insurance policy, the insurance coverage business supplies several options to select at the very least one index to utilize for all or component of the cash money value account sector of your policy and your survivor benefit.
Cash money value, along with possible development of that worth with an equity index account. An alternative to allocate component of the cash money value to a set interest option.
Insurance policy holders can decide the percentage alloted to the dealt with and indexed accounts. The worth of the selected index is videotaped at the start of the month and contrasted with the value at the end of the month. If the index raises during the month, passion is included to the money worth.
The resulting rate of interest is included to the money value. Some plans compute the index gains as the sum of the changes for the duration, while other plans take an average of the everyday gains for a month.
The rate is established by the insurer and can be anywhere from 25% to more than 100%. (The insurance company can likewise alter the take part rate over the life time of the plan.) If the gain is 6%, the involvement rate is 50%, and the present cash money worth total amount is $10,000, $300 is added to the cash value (6% x 50% x $10,000 = $300).
There are a variety of benefits and drawbacks to think about before purchasing an IUL policy.: Just like typical global life insurance policy, the insurance holder can raise their premiums or lower them in times of hardship.: Quantities attributed to the money worth expand tax-deferred. The money worth can pay the insurance coverage costs, enabling the policyholder to decrease or stop making out-of-pocket costs settlements.
Several IUL policies have a later maturity day than other kinds of global life plans, with some finishing when the insured reaches age 121 or more. If the insured is still to life back then, plans pay the survivor benefit (yet not usually the cash money worth) and the proceeds may be taxed.
: Smaller plan stated value do not provide much advantage over normal UL insurance coverage policies.: If the index decreases, no passion is attributed to the money worth. (Some plans provide a reduced guaranteed rate over a longer period.) Other financial investment automobiles use market indexes as a criteria for efficiency.
With IUL, the objective is to benefit from higher movements in the index.: Because the insurer just acquires choices in an index, you're not directly bought stocks, so you do not benefit when business pay rewards to shareholders.: Insurers fee fees for managing your cash, which can drain pipes money worth.
For lots of people, no, IUL isn't better than a 401(k) in regards to saving for retirement. Most IULs are best for high-net-worth people looking for ways to decrease their taxable income or those who have maxed out their various other retirement alternatives. For every person else, a 401(k) is a much better financial investment lorry because it does not bring the high fees and premiums of an IUL, plus there is no cap on the quantity you might gain (unlike with an IUL policy).
While you may not lose any money in the account if the index goes down, you will not gain rate of interest. The high price of premiums and charges makes IULs pricey and significantly less inexpensive than term life.

When your chosen index gains worth, so as well does your policy's cash money worth. Your IUL money value will also have a minimum rate of interest that it will constantly make, no matter market efficiency. Your IUL may also have a rate of interest cap. An IUL policy operates similarly as a traditional universal life plan, with the exemption of how its cash money value makes interest.

Right here are some variables that you should think about when figuring out whether a IUL plan was right for you:: IULs are complicated economic products. Make certain your broker totally clarified how they work, consisting of the prices, financial investment dangers, and cost frameworks. There are more affordable choices readily available if a survivor benefit is being looked for by an investor.
These can considerably reduce your returns. If your Broker fell short to give a thorough description of the expenses for the policy this can be a red flag. Recognize surrender charges if you determine to cancel the plan early.: The financial investment component of a IUL undergoes market changes and have a cap on returns (meaning that the insurance policy company gets the advantage of stellar market performance and the financier's gains are covered).
: Guarantee you were outlined and are able to pay enough premiums to maintain the plan effective. Underfunding can result in policy gaps and loss of insurance coverage. If your Broker fails to explain that costs repayments are required, this could be a warning. It is critical to extensively research and comprehend the terms, charges, and potential threats of an IUL plan.
Conventional development investments can usually be combined with more affordable insurance coverage options if a death benefit is necessary to a capitalist. IULs are excluded from government law under the Dodd-Frank Act, meaning they are not overseen by the united state Securities and Exchange Compensation (SEC) like stocks and alternatives. Insurance representatives marketing IULs are just required to be certified by the state, not to undergo the same rigorous training as financiers.
